Portlethen and District Community Allotment Association Awarded National Lottery Funding for Coastal Growing Tunnel

  • Submitted by: Audrey Nicoll, Aberdeen South and North Kincardine, Scottish National Party.
  • Date lodged: Friday, 01 November 2024
  • Motion reference: S6M-15161
  • Current status: Fallen

That the Parliament congratulates Portlethen and District Community Allotment Association on being awarded an £8,382 grant from the National Lottery Community Fund; recognises that this will allow it to purchase a solid polycarbonate growing tunnel designed to withstand the region's coastal winds, which will provide a resilient space for growing seedlings and hosting community gatherings all year-round, and commends the association's commitment to creating a sustainable and inclusive community space that promotes gardening and resilience among residents.
